Rapid and simultaneous analysis of 16‐<i>O</i>‐methylcafestol and sterols as markers for assessment of green coffee bean authenticity by on‐line LC‐GC

Abstract An on‐line LC‐GC method for analysis of 16‐ O ‐methylcafestol (16‐OMC) and total sterols in oils obtained from green beans of Coffea canephora (Robusta) and C. arabica (Arabica) has been developed. HPLC pre‐separation of the transesterified lipids allows quantification of the content of 16‐OMC. The fraction containing the sterols is transferred to on‐line GC analysis. The results obtained for Arabica and Robusta samples were in good agreement with literature data obtained by classical analytical procedures. The method allows rapid and simultaneous determination of two markers (16‐OMC and Δ 5 ‐avenasterol) proposed for authenticity assessment of coffee beans and overcomes time‐consuming sample pretreatment steps.
